Also important to note tag and license are calendar year so December and January would be separate tags and license

Hunting license is a year from when you buy it (they changed it a few years ago), or if you buy it online you can specify the start date within certain limits from when you buy it. OTC archery deer tag is a calendar year (Jan. 1 to Dec. 31).
